Transaction 340ca96f812e3a8979b735190ec88e9abee1ae97d39dd8d18795d9425f91c368
1 Input
1 Output
-
340ca96f812e3a8979b735190ec88e9abee1ae97d39dd8d18795d9425f91c368:0
- value
- 39321
- script pubkey
- OP_0 OP_PUSHBYTES_20 307ea61db344ba1b1dcf5bd96176ce1ce01067f4
- address
- bc1qxpl2v8dngjapk8w0t0vkzakwrnspqel50flyjy